1555 Covington Ave Piqua, OH 45356
Covington Plaza, a single-story, 16,104 square foot retail strip center, presents a compelling investment opportunity in Piqua, Ohio. Built in 1972, this established center boasts seven suites and enjoys a high-traffic location at the southeast corner of SR 36 (Covington Avenue) and Sunset Drive. Currently, the center houses a diverse mix of established tenants including Hothead Burrito, Cassano's Pizza, Sundown Tan, Subway, and Speedway Gas, ensuring a consistent stream of customer traffic. One suite, measuring 3,797 square feet, is currently available for lease. The center's strategic placement directly across from a large 65,000 square foot Kroger grocery store, and other national retailers, further enhances its visibility and accessibility.
